WebThe United States has limited experience launching nuclear reactors into space to provide power for satellites. A single reactor, the SNAP 10A was launched in 1965, but since that time WebThe SNAP-10A has three major components – (1) a compact fission reactor that generates heat, (2) an energy converter that transforms some of the heat into electricity, and (3) a radiator that radiates away heat that cannot be used. Can a Seattle Start-Up … Webreactors in orbit operated for no longer than 1 year. Most of the reactors were of BUK design with ~3kWe output, which featured U-Mo fuel, Na-Ka coolant and thermocouple power conversion. 3. The two reactors sent into orbit in 1987 were of thermionic design named Topaz-1 (5-7 kWe). They employed the so-called multiple
